Based on Nvidia's and AMD's algorithms, "Performance" might use an internal resolution of 540p while "Quality" could scale up from 720p. The minimum requirement accounts for an "Upscale Performance Setting," and the recommended spec includes an "Upscale Quality Setting." The phrasing suggests the game uses an image-upscaling algorithm like AMD's FSR (Nvidia's DLSS wouldn't work on any of the listed GPUs) or possibly a custom solution from Avalanche. The open-world fantasy prequel to the Harry Potter franchise from Avalanche Software and Warner Bros studios requires at least a GTX 1070 or an RX Vega 56 to play at 1080p and 60fps with low graphics settings. However, they are steep compared to other recent high-profile games at that resolution. Unlike some recent high-profile titles that provide multiple tiers of requirements for resolutions like 1440p and 4K, Hogwarts Legacy so far only lists "Minimum" and "Recommended" specs for 1080p gameplay.
